Line chart

A line chart shows data points that are connected by straight line segments. Use a line chart to show trends and changes over continuous intervals, such as time.

Line charts reveal patterns, rates of change, and the overall data direction, enabling identification of increases, decreases, and fluctuations across datasets.

Use line charts for:

  • Time-based data analysis
  • Performance tracking
  • Comparative trend analysis across datasets
